Jon Favreau Returning to 'Iron Man 3' -- as an Actor (Exclusive)

Jon Favreau isn't directing Iron Man 3, but he'll be present on the set.
Sources tell The Hollywood Reporter that Favreau has closed a deal to reprise his role of Happy Hogan -- the bodyguard-sidekick to Tony Stark/Iron Man, played by Robert Downey Jr. -- in the Marvel Studios threequel.

The movie began shooting Wednesday in North Carolina under the direction of Shane Black (Kiss Kiss Bang Bang). It's the first production for Marvel in the aftermath of the billion-dollar success of The Avengers.
Iron Man 3 will feature returning co-star Gwyneth Paltrow as Pepper Potts and a slew of newcomers: Rebecca Hall, Guy Pearce, Ben Kingsley, James Badge Dale and Ashley Hamilton.
Favreau directed the first two Iron Man movies; he appeared as Hogan in a cameo in the first movie and played an expanded part in Iron Man 2.

It is unclear how big the role is in the third movie, but having Favreau return as Hogan seems like a sign of solidarity on Favreau and Marvel’s part and an endorsement of Black.
